Force Majeure: It’s Out of Control “Force majeure” is one of those legal terms that might be hard to explain (and spell), but you know it when you see it. Florida Property Owners Want Breweries

More and more property owners want to include breweries in their commercial spaces. As one example, here’s a listing for a commercial development in Eustis looking for a brewery tenant. Property owners recognize that brewery/taprooms bring in people.
